Entity域限制:允许特定数值

56次阅读

共计 825 个字符,预计需要花费 3 分钟才能阅读完成。

在编程和数据处理中,对于一些特殊要求的场景,通常需要进行某些设置或限制。这可以是针对数据类型的限制,例如允许特定数值、不允许负数等。这种约束往往是为了确保代码的健壮性,避免出现潜在的问题,如除以零的情况。

限制数值范围

  1. 允许特定数值

在编程中,对于一些特殊的数据类型或实体进行设置时,可能会遇到需要限定某些值的情况。例如,在处理财务数据时,可能希望所有数字都是正数且不超过某个上限;在表示货币价值时,只有正值才被认为是有效的。这种限制通常是为了确保计算的准确性及避免出现负数导致的操作失误。

  1. 不允许负数

对于一些特定的数据类型或实体,如果允许负数,则可能会引入错误。例如,在处理年龄、体重等数值时,不接受负值是合理的;在表示生物物种的种群数量时,只有正值才被认为是有效的。这种限制可以帮助确保数据的一致性,避免由于非预期的负值而导致的结果误差。

确保计算准确性

限制特定数值的范围可以提高代码的健壮性和准确性。例如,在处理财务报表中,如果允许负数,则可能会出现诸如债务、亏损等非正常的资产或负债记录;在表示货币价值时,不接受负数则有助于确保交易中的财务平衡。

避免错误和异常

限制特定数值可以帮助避免潜在的计算错误和程序崩溃。例如,在处理金融数据时,如果允许负值,则可能会导致计算结果的不合理性,甚至可能导致错误的结果;在表示物种数量时,如果只接受正数,则可以确保种群的数量是可信的。

对于大型系统

对于涉及到大量数据的系统或应用,限制特定数值范围可以帮助提高系统的稳定性。例如,在处理医疗记录时,允许负值可能会对病人的健康信息造成混淆;而在表示生物物种多样性时,如果只接受正数,则可以确保种群数量的真实性和准确性。

结论

在编程和数据处理中设置特定的数值限制是一种常见的做法,旨在提高代码的健壮性、避免潜在的问题。这不仅有助于维护系统的稳定性和可靠性,也有助于提升用户或应用程序的数据质量。因此,在设计系统时,应考虑适当的数值限制策略,以满足业务需求并确保程序运行的正确性。

正文完
 0